(1广西玉林容县气象局 广西玉林 537500;2北流市气象局 广西北流 537400)
摘要:本文针对容县农业气象服务发展的实际,设计开发了气象为农服务网站。容县气象为农服务网站的主题是“气象服务”,利用AppServ网页建站包和EmpireCMS v6.6安装包,完成PHP、Apache、MySQ、phpMyAdmin和网站后台管理系统的组建,实现了农业信息、农业技术、气候资源、防灾减灾、气象监测、气象预测、气象服务、科普宣传、信息快报的浏览、查询和管理。
关键词:气象为农 网站 开发设计 实现
引言
随着社会经济和科学技术的快速发展,气象服务内涵和服务领域均得到了拓展,再加上现代信息技术在农业领域中的广泛应用,气象为农服务成为了农业现代和信息化的基础和重要标志。但是气象为农服务的传播手段和发展方式仍旧较为落后,绝大部分的为农气象服务产品都是通过电子邮件、书面等的形式向决策管理部门传送,服务面狭窄,很容易导致众多部门对天气预报的片面理解。气象为农服务信息的传播途径和发布手段有限,再加上传播环节薄弱,即使气象部门引进了电子显示屏、手机短信、大喇叭等平台,但是也很难保证为农气象服务信息能及时传递到每位农民手中,农业气象服务的时效性也很难得到保证。当前,县级气象部门建立了官方网站,其内容大都是实时信息报道和天气预报信息,不定时宣传气象科普知识,但仍旧不能满足农业生产中的需求,很难将农业气象服务产品的作用充分发挥出来。因此,本文结合容县农业生产实际,研发了容县气象为农服务网站,以期为农业生产者和管理者提供针对性强的气象服务信息,以降低气象灾害对农业生产的危害,确保农业高产丰收。
1、网站开发技术与结构
1.1开发技术
积极搭建以PHP+Apache+MySQL进行结合的网站环境,这种方法在网站建设过程中使用的较为广泛,其主要特点是稳定性强、扩展性好、易于操作和维护。借助于AppServ网页建站包和EmpireCMS v6.6安装包,完成PHP、Apache、MySQ、phpMyAdmin和网站后台管理系统的组建。EmpireCMS属于网站信息管理系统,其主要作用是为网站提供管理和系统扩展的框架。利用PHP对Web应用程序进行开发,自身的安全性能较高,执行速度快,且支持广泛的数据库和面向对象。通过B/S方式实现为农服务数据获取、加工制作、管理发布流程的集约化、规范化和高效化管理,最终完成容县气象为农服务网站整体框架的设计和信息发布。
1.2网站结构
气象监测和预测以及气象为农服务作为主线,将农业信息与技术、气候资源与防灾减灾、科普宣传、信息快报等作为整个网站的搭建内容。在EmpireCMS v6.6安装包的作用下实现对栏目的命名、目录和栏目类型的设置等。在网站后台将新建数据表、自定义字段、搭建适用的系统模型和栏目版块进行结合,在每个栏目中设置对应的数据表,且能根据实际需要为每个数据表进行相应的分类。容县气象为农服务网站主要有农业信息、农业技术、气候资源、防灾减灾、气象监测、气象预测、气象服务、科普宣传、信息快报共九个模块。
2、主要模块设计与实现
2.1农业信息与技术
将EmpireCMS系统模型应用到农业信息与农业技术栏目中,并综合栏目事先设置好的页面、列表、内容模块等,发布同农业政策、粮食生产动态、作物生长发育、病虫害防治、关键农事季节安排等方面的信息。对模块、目录和上传的信息及时进行更新、发布,在信息编辑完成后需及时提交,随后对其进行刷新,相应栏目、列表信息和内容更新完成。
期刊文章分类查询,尽在期刊图书馆
2.2气候资源和气象防灾减灾
对于气候资源和气象防灾减灾栏目中主要使用了EmpireCMC信息系统模型,实现将模板固定好,将相关栏目、内容和信息展现出来。气候资源栏目中应包含容县境内各乡镇地理位置、主要农作物、气候带、气象灾害等方面的信息。结合容县近些年来的气象资料信息,将容县年平均气温、降水量和日照时数资料以趋势图的方式展现,同时还要展现各个气象要素的极端最低和最高值分布情况;干旱、暴雨、大风、霜冻、冰雹、寒潮等气象灾害时空分布特征及其产生的危害等,同时结合容县实际,提出科学有效的气象防灾减灾措施,以更好的为农业生产服务。
2.3气象监测
气象监测信息的内容主要有卫星云图、今日天气、自动气象站和区域气象站的气温、降水量、日照时数等气象要素的查询;借助于卫星云图、天气和自动站数据插件可以将最新的气象要素数据调取出来,方便用户实时查看。通过PHP编程语言,可以对自动站、区域站观测到的气象要素数据进行分析和显示功能的开发,用户对自动站和区域数据库进行访问的过程中,可以调取出对应的气象要素数据信息,以实现相关功能的应用。
2.4气象预测
通过气象预测信息栏目可以将容县短期、中期气象预测方面的信息显示出来,同时还能显示预报产品和预警信息等。借助于后台处理程序,对容县气象局数据存储器制定目录下的气象预测、预警产品进行自动调取,随后在网站制定位置处显示,点击网站前台设置的对应栏目可以实现气象数据的查询。
2.5气象服务
气象服务栏目是气象为农服务网站的主要栏目。主要利用EmpereCMS flash系统模型,建立起对应数据表、列表模块和页面模块,进而设置气候分析、农用预报、干旱服务、专题气象服务四个子栏目,并在对应的子栏目中发布相应的气象为农服务产品。利用后台管理系统设置的用户,可以将之前生成的SWF格式的业务服务产品上传到子栏目中,方便用户实时查阅。气候分析主要是以月、季、年为时间节点发布相应的气候分析和预测;农用预报主要是不定期或定期发布现代农业与气象、设施农业服务、农业气象旬报、作物专项服务等气象产品,对农作物各个生长阶段的气象条件进行分析评价、农业气象灾害影响、关键农事生产建议等服务;干旱服务主要是针对容县各个区域内的逐旬气温、降水、土壤水分变化进行分析;专题气象服务则主要是针对春耕春播、秋收秋种、季度气候影响和评价等的专题气象服务产品,并对这些气象服务信息进行实时上传、更新和发布,确保农民可以及时了解。
科普宣传和信息快报栏目采用了EmpereCMS新闻系统模型,主要是向农民群众宣传农业气象灾害、气象灾害防御等方面的知识,例如“干旱的危害和防御”、“降水预警信息”、“大风预警信息”、“关键农事季节的注意事项”、“气象条件对农业生产的影响”等内容,在容县积极宣传气象知识和农业灾害知识,确保农民可以使用科学有效的方式防御气象灾害。信息快报可以将气象为农服务最新动态、温度、降水量等信息第一时间发布出去。栏目的信息管理同时支持数据库式和目录式的管理,可以根据栏目对附件进行管理,用户可以上传或删除相应的信息。
3结论
该网站设计灵活,无需重新开发设计,只要统筹规划、定制服务产品的分类和内容,梳理和补充用户信息,对当地的地理信息和观测数据源、访问信息等进行替换,就能快速构建气象为农服务网站,比较适宜在其他地区推广应用。
参考文献
[1]张义豪.阳谷县农业气象服务平台介绍[J].山东气象,2015,35(3).
[2]薛龙琴.河南省农业气象服务平台的设计与实现[J].气象与环境科学,2015,38(4).
第一作者简介:李奎兰(1982-)女,汉族,广西容县人,本科,工程师,从事地面观测、天气预报服务工作。
论文作者:李奎兰1,林堃儒2
论文发表刊物:《科技研究》2018年7期
论文发表时间:2018/9/11
标签:气象论文; 容县论文; 信息论文; 栏目论文; 农业论文; 气候资源论文; 灾害论文; 《科技研究》2018年7期论文;